Page 3: Igneous Rocks Crystals -. Igneous Rocks. Cut these statements up and stick them in the right order in your book Lava is the name for magma which comes

Igneous Rocks•

• Inside the Earth is magma. This is molten rock.• Volcanoes erupt and magma comes to the

Earth’s surface• Lava is the name for magma which comes to the

surface.• Lava cools quickly, making igneous rocks with

small crystals• • The magma which cools slowly makes • igneous rocks with large crystals. •
